Chris Martin has opened up about his relationship with Gwyneth Paltrow.
The Coldplay frontman rarely discusses his high-profile romance, but admitted on US TV that he feels like he has won the lottery.
Speaking to CBS' Sunday Morning, he confirmed that Paltrow is his first serious relationship. "That's right," he said. "I'm in it."
When host Anthony Mason pointed out that going from no serious relationships to being settled down with a family was "quite a leap", Martin joked "It's a big leap? What, from being a loser, to going out with an Oscar winner?
"It's a giant leap. Let's face it; it's like winning the lottery."
The couple have been married since 2003, and have two children together - Moses, five, and Apple, seven. Chris revealed that being a father has given him "purpose".
"I like what it does. Just the idea of having to work hard so your kids are okay."
Coldplay release their new album Mylo Xyloto on October 24.
